Output 18b2fbc4114e1b075dc686b3b3aeb0a1acf8d76e822d7cda0b0ef3197e2b5b6a:2

value
2323955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0334d0caef1531e7713151c4c9fed08c42637405 OP_EQUAL
address
31yyDp1DXYUJn2bgdBQKmmuKZw2WLCWgEh
transaction
18b2fbc4114e1b075dc686b3b3aeb0a1acf8d76e822d7cda0b0ef3197e2b5b6a
confirmations
263
spent
true